Venezuela's interior minister, Diosdado Cabello, reported that 100 people died in a U.S. attack that removed President Nicolas Maduro. Previously, only 23 military deaths were confirmed. Cuba reported 32 of its personnel were killed. Maduro and his wife, Cilia Flores, were injured. Interim President Delcy Rodriguez declared a week of mourning for the military casualties.
